Output 1524916d9356036cb27d1671176a2dcdb0da434bdf875efc383976617beb326d:0

value
20000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e60411c9e976384bca84280be6aaf539b93485d5 OP_EQUALVERIFY OP_CHECKSIG
address
1MyDHsgsrAJXfRBGYhJftFagi5uSs5E7ou
transaction
1524916d9356036cb27d1671176a2dcdb0da434bdf875efc383976617beb326d
confirmations
754199
spent
true